An Unusual Agriculture Path
Growing up outside Houston, Austin Jasek took an unconventional route to his role as Poultry Account Manager for Zinpro®. After being introduced to FFA, he built backyard pens to raise 50 broilers and a dozen turkeys in his suburban neighborhood.
In his senior year, he kept a show steer named Amos in a pasture near his high school. From then on, he knew he wanted to work with animals.
A Focus on Poultry Research
While attending Texas A&M, Austin discovered a deep interest in the science behind poultry nutrition, and an appreciation for the speed of production. With broilers reaching maturity in just 60 days, he could quickly see the impact of making nutritional and management changes.
Working in a poultry research lab reinforced his interest in research and prompted him to pursue a PhD in poultry nutrition.
